What happened
In 1880, Theodore Tilton relocated to Paris, France, seeking a fresh start after the scandal that marred his reputation in the United States. This move represented a significant shift in his life, as he immersed himself in the vibrant literary and artistic culture of the city.
Literary impact
Living in Paris allowed Tilton to connect with other expatriate writers and artists, influencing his poetic style and themes. The city's artistic environment inspired him to explore new ideas and perspectives, enriching his body of work during this period.
